Carbon Monoxide Alarms 2015 IRC Section R315 New Construction an approved carbon monoxide alarm installed outside of each sleeping area in the immediate vicinity of bedroom and dwelling units. They shall be listed as complying with UL 2034 and installed accordingly Fasteners for Preservative treated wood 2015 IRC Code Section R402.1.1 Fastner for Preservative treated wood shall be of hot dipped zinc-coated galvanized steel, stainless steel, silicon bronze or copper. Exceptions: 1. One-half inch (12.7mm) diameter or greater steel bolts. 2. Fasteners other than nail & timber rivets shall be permitted to be of mechanical deposited zinc coated steel with coating weights in accordance with ASTM B695 class 55 min. Frost Protection 403.1.4.1 Except where otherwise protected from frost, foundation walls, piers and other permanent supports of buildings and structures shall be protected from frost by one or more of the following methods: 1. Extended below the frost line specified in Table R301.2 2. Construct in accordance with Section 403.3 3. Construct in accordance with ASCE 32 or 4. Erected on Solid Rock Exceptions: -Protection of freestanding accessory structures with an area of 400 of 600 square feet or less, of light frame construction with an eve height of 10' of less shall not be required. -Decks not supported by a dwelling need not be provided with footings that extend below the frost line. -Footings shall not bear on frozen soil unless the frozen condition is permanent. Ventilation 2015 IRC Section R408 The under-floor space between the bottom of the floor joists and the earth under any building (except space occupied by a basement) shall have ventilation openings through foundation walls or exterior walls. The minimum net area of ventilation opening shall not be less than 1 s/f for each 150/f of under floor space area, unless the ground surface is covered by a Class 1 vapor retarder material. If the vapor retarder is used the min. net area of ventilation openings shall not be less than 1 s/f for each 1500 s/f. One such vent shall be within 3' of each corner of building.
